Story Conjunctions

This English scheme of work for Key Stage Two gets the children to identify and model how to link clauses in sentences related to some of the special characters and events that feature in different stories. The class can use conjunctions in sentences to indicate the importance of characters, settings and events,

Story Sentences
Practise using different conjunctions to link clauses in example sentences about special characters that might feature in specific types of stories

Story Characters
Explore and record how to use a range of conjunctions to link sentence clauses about special characters that can feature in different stories

Billy Goats Gruff
Investigate and illustrate how to link pairs of sentence clauses using the conjunction when to describe things that happened in a traditional story

Three Little Pigs
Investigate and illustrate how to link pairs of sentence clauses using the conjunction because to describe things that happened in a traditional story
